Australia vs. China: Competing Interests in the Solomon Islands
The geopolitical surroundings is swiftly changing as Australia and China work to increase their sway over the Solomon Islands—a key player within the Pacific domain.Both nations are utilizing diverse strategies such as financial support, infrastructure initiatives, and strategic partnerships to gain favor among its roughly 700,000 inhabitants. This rivalry reflects broader regional tensions driven by each power’s aspirations.
Historically regarded as a primary ally in this area, Australia is now capitalizing on its long-standing relationships while committing resources aimed at ensuring stability. In contrast, China aims to expand its influence through significant investments and developmental aid. As both countries present their proposals to residents of the Solomon Islands,discussions regarding potential long-term implications for national interests are becoming more pronounced. Their approaches include:
- Financial Support: Investments directed towards enhancing infrastructure.
- Diplomatic Engagement: High-profile visits paired with formal agreements.
- Security Collaborations: Initiatives designed to promote regional stability.
